Отображение количества добавленных товаров в чеке определяется параметром showGoodsQuantity в конфигурационном файле /linuxcash/cash/conf/ncash.ini.d/gui.ini:

  • при значении параметра true на экране отображается общее количество добавленных в чек товаров,
  • при значении параметра false общее количество добавленных товаров не отображается.
НаименованиеТип данныхВозможные значенияОписаниеПримечания
showGoodsQuantityлогический
  • true
  • false
Отображать количество добавленных товаровПо умолчанию false
Пример настройки
; Отображать количество добавленных товаров
; По умолчанию false
;showGoodsQuantity = false

Отображение общего количества при добавлении штучных и весовых товаров

Отображение общего количества при добавлении штучных и весовых товаров выполняется в зависимости от настройки unitePosition ("Объединение товарных позиций").

Без объединения позиций

При повторном добавлении или применении модификатора "Количество":

  • для штучного товара – отображается общее количество добавленных товаров, увеличенное на количество добавленных позиций,
  • для весового товара – отображается общее количество добавленных товаров, увеличенное на 1 (независимо от веса).
Пример. Расчет общего количества добавленных товаров в чеке без объединения позиций

showGoodsQuantity = true
unitePosition = disable

Позиции:

  1. ВАРЕНЕЦ БМК 2.5% 450Г ПЮР/ПАК (1 шт)
    Вклад в общее количество добавленных товаров = 1
  2. МОЛОКО БМК 1.5% 1Л П/П (1 шт)
    Вклад в общее количество добавленных товаров = 1
  3. МОЛОКО БМК 1.5% 1Л П/П (9 шт)
    Вклад в общее количество добавленных товаров = 9
  4. Картофель (2.780 кг)
    Вклад в общее количество добавленных товаров = 1
  5. Картофель (3.320 кг)
    Вклад в общее количество добавленных товаров = 1

Общее количество добавленных товаров = 13

С объединением позиций

При повторном добавлении или применении модификатора "Количество":

  • для штучного товара – отображается общее количество добавленных товаров, увеличенное на количество добавленных позиций, полученное после объединения,
  • для весового товара – отображается общее количество добавленных товаров без изменений.
Пример. Расчет общего количества добавленных товаров в чеке с объединением позиций

showGoodsQuantity = true
unitePosition = all

Позиции:

  1. ВАРЕНЕЦ БМК 2.5% 450Г ПЮР/ПАК (1 шт)
    Вклад в общее количество добавленных товаров = 1
  2. МОЛОКО БМК 1.5% 1Л П/П (1 шт) + МОЛОКО БМК 1.5% 1Л П/П (9 шт)
    Вклад в общее количество добавленных товаров = 10
  3. Картофель (2.780 кг) + Картофель (3.320 кг)
    Вклад в общее количество добавленных товаров = 1

Общее количество добавленных товаров = 12

  • No labels